According to Shelly & Miller (2006) spiritual care means putting people in touch with God through compassionate presence active listening witness prayer Bible readings and partnering with body of Christ (the church community and clergy. As a nurse spiritual care is respecting and supporting my patient religious beliefs or religious preference meaning respecting their automy regarding medical decision and not insisting my own preference. Spiritual care is a talking and listening to their spiritual needs like giving time and privacy regarding spiritual rituals or prayers.

Spiritual care involves active listening encouragement expressing faith and hope (Shelly & Miller 2006). As for me it the same and not much of a difference the spiritual care that I believe spiritual care is simply being actively present when you are needed pray whenever ask to reflecting and sharing Bible passage and gospel offering a word of advice as it relate to their spirituality and offering prayer and words of encouragement. This includes making referrals for health services and government agency for assistance and providing help for clergy and pastor presence. Spiritual care for me also is giving compassionate care by being attentive to their needs on timely basis. As a Christian spiritual care is bringing hope to our patient who are in despair and losing hope in their battle with their illness and restoring their relationship to Jesus and spreading his words and gospel to encourage them to repent and confess their sins and bring back their trust to God.
